How Do You Put A Subscript In Word?

Select the text or number that you want. For superscript, press Ctrl, Shift, and the Plus sign (+) at the same time. For subscript, press Ctrl and the Equal sign (=) at the same time .

How do you make a subscript in Word on a Mac?

You can also use keyboard shortcuts to quickly apply superscript or subscript to selected text. For superscript, press Control-Shift-Command-Plus Sign (+) . For subscript, press Control-Command-Minus Sign (-).

How do I make the first letter big in Word?

Select the first character of a paragraph. Go to INSERT > Drop Cap . Select the drop cap option you want. To create a drop cap that fits within your paragraph, select Dropped.

What is the shortcut key of font size?

To do this Press Increase the font size. Ctrl+Shift+Right angle bracket (>) Decrease the font size. Ctrl+Shift+Left angle bracket (<) Increase the font size by 1 point. Ctrl+Right bracket (]) Decrease the font size by 1 point. Ctrl+Left bracket ([)

How do I automatically capitalize the first letter in Word?

To use a keyboard shortcut to change between lowercase, UPPERCASE, and Capitalize Each Word, select the text and press SHIFT + F3 until the case you want is applied.

How do you type a small 2?

Hold down Alt and key in 0178 and let go of Alt . A superscript 2 will appear. Incidentally, if you needed ‘cubed’ instead of ‘squared’ then type 0179 and you’ll get a superscript 3. In fact, this will work anywhere in Windows or online – even in Word.
